Searched refs:m_div (Results 1 – 3 of 3) sorted by relevance
/linux-6.1.9/drivers/clk/nxp/ |
D | clk-lpc32xx.c | 326 unsigned long m_div; member 485 clk->m_div = ((val & PLL_CTRL_FEEDDIV) >> 1) + 1; in clk_pll_recalc_rate() 504 rate = cco_rate = ref_rate * clk->m_div; in clk_pll_recalc_rate() 519 clk->n_div, clk->m_div, (1 << clk->p_div), rate); in clk_pll_recalc_rate() 543 val |= (clk->m_div - 1) << 1; in clk_pll_set_rate() 545 new_rate = (parent_rate * clk->m_div) / clk->n_div; in clk_pll_set_rate() 558 val |= (clk->m_div - 1) << 1; in clk_pll_set_rate() 561 new_rate = (parent_rate * clk->m_div) / clk->n_div; in clk_pll_set_rate() 565 val |= (clk->m_div - 1) << 1; in clk_pll_set_rate() 568 new_rate = (parent_rate * clk->m_div) / in clk_pll_set_rate() [all …]
|
/linux-6.1.9/drivers/media/dvb-frontends/ |
D | stv0900_core.c | 287 u32 m_div, clk_sel; in stv0900_set_mclk() local 299 m_div = ((clk_sel * mclk) / intp->quartz) - 1; in stv0900_set_mclk() 300 stv0900_write_bits(intp, F0900_M_DIV, m_div); in stv0900_set_mclk() 310 m_div = intp->mclk / 704000; in stv0900_set_mclk() 311 stv0900_write_reg(intp, R0900_P1_F22TX, m_div); in stv0900_set_mclk() 312 stv0900_write_reg(intp, R0900_P1_F22RX, m_div); in stv0900_set_mclk() 314 stv0900_write_reg(intp, R0900_P2_F22TX, m_div); in stv0900_set_mclk() 315 stv0900_write_reg(intp, R0900_P2_F22RX, m_div); in stv0900_set_mclk()
|
/linux-6.1.9/drivers/media/i2c/ |
D | ov8865.c | 523 unsigned int m_div; member 720 .m_div = 1, 731 .m_div = 1, 1646 OV8865_PLL_CTRL3_M_DIV(config->m_div)); in ov8865_mode_pll1_configure() 2120 return pll1_rate / config->m_div / 2; in ov8865_mode_mipi_clk_rate()
|